Abstract

We study the (canonical) 1st derivatives of proper submersions represented as height functions and belonging to a certain class: a proper map means a map the preimage of a compact set by which is always compact. We investigate their Reeb spaces. They are the quotient spaces defined by the equivalence relations on the manifolds of the domains where we identify two points in a same connected component of a same level set of them. They have been important since the establishment of theory of Morse functions, in the 20th century, They are in certain tame situations 0- or 1-dimensional and graphs naturally. Related facts have been shown by Gelbukh and Saeki in the 2020s for certain proper smooth real-valued functions. In non-proper cases, even related explicit theory has been difficult, except some previously given case of the author. Our study is on a new related case.
